SEC 8-2 (10 games plus championship)
Texas Bowl ESPN
Houston, TXDec 29, 2015 • 9:00 PM ET
#20 LSU 56 Texas Tech 27
MVP Leonard Fournette 29/212 4TD, 1/44 1TD
Birmingham Bowl ESPN
Birmingham AL Dec 30, 2015 • 12:00 PM ET
Auburn 31 Memphis 10
MVP Jovon Robinson 27/126 1TD
Belk Bowl ESPN
Charlotte, NC Dec 30, 2015 • 3:30 PM ET
NC State 28 Mississippi State 51
MVP Dak Prescott 25/42 380, 4TD passes. 47 yds rushing
Music City Bowl ESPN
Nashville, TN Dec 30, 2015 • 7:00 PM ET
Texas A&M 21 Louisville 27
Cotton Bowl, CFP Semi ESPN
Arlington, TX Dec 31, 2015 • 8:00 PM ET
#3 Michigan State 0 #2 Alabama 38
MVPs Offense: Jacob Coker 25/30 286 2TD, Defense: Cyrus Jones 1 int (only time MSU made it to FG range) Punt return for TD
Outback Bowl ESPN2
Tampa, FL Jan 1, 2016 • 12:00 PM ET
#13 Northwestern 6 #23 Tennessee 45
MVP Jalen Hurd 24/130 TD
Citrus Bowl ABC
Orlando, FL Jan 1, 2016 • 1:00 PM ET
#14 Michigan 41 #19 Florida 7
Sugar Bowl ESPN
New Orleans, LA Jan 1, 2016 • 8:30 PM ET
#16 Oklahoma State 20 #12 Ole Miss 48
MVP Chad Kelly 21/33 302 4 TD 1 Int, rushing 10/73
TaxSlayer Bowl ESPN
Jacksonville, FL Jan 2, 2016 • 12:00 PM ET
Penn State 17 Georgia 24
MVP Terry Godwin (freshman WR) 1/44 1 TD passing, 4/34 receiving 1 TD
Liberty Bowl ESPN
Memphis, TN Jan 2, 2016 • 3:20 PM ET
Kansas State 23 Arkansas 45
MVP Alex Collins 23/185, 3 TD
College Football Playoff Championship 7:30 ET ESPN
Glendale AZ
#2 Alabama (13-1, 7-1 SEC)
#1 Clemson (14-0, 8-0 ACC)
